<!--// Copyright 1997 RoundTable Media, Inc.  All Rights Reserved.// set up error trappingtrapErrors=false;  // for debugging, set to false.  if true no javascript error dialogs will appeareventsActive=false;selectedButton="";selectedParent="";selectedChildNum=0;window.onerror = getTrapErrors;// Set up the platform-appropriate style sheet// Disable CSS for buggy browser versionsfullversion=navigator.appName + navigator.appVersion;if (fullversion.indexOf("Netscape") != -1) {	if (!window.saveInnerWidth) {	  window.saveInnerWidth = window.innerWidth;	  window.saveInnerHeight = window.innerHeight;	}	window.onResize=resizeFix;}// return the current debugMode settingfunction getTrapErrors() {	return trapErrors;}// if the browser supports it, load in the image objects for the buttonsfunction setupButtons(rbtnName) {	selectedButton=rbtnName	selectedParent=""	selectedChildNum=0				if(setupButtons.arguments.length>=2) {		selectedParent=setupButtons.arguments[1]	}	if(setupButtons.arguments.length==3) {		selectedChildNum=setupButtons.arguments[2]	}	}// For javascript-based listbox jump// Determine which page is selected and go to itfunction selectPage(form) { i = form.listboxmenu.selectedIndex; if (i != 0) { 		loc=form.listboxmenu.options[i].value;		nav(loc);	}}function nav(loc) {				// open the location in the main window  top.location.href = loc;}// Displays the date in a nice format// Uses either the date object, or document.lastmodifiedfunction writeDate() {	// Array of day names	var dayNames = new makeArray(7);	dayNames[0]="Sunday";	dayNames[1]="Monday";	dayNames[2]="Tuesday";	dayNames[3]="Wednesday";	dayNames[4]="Thursday";	dayNames[5]="Friday";	dayNames[6]="Saturday";			// Array of month Names	var monthNames = new makeArray(12);	monthNames[0]="January";	monthNames[1]="February";	monthNames[2]="March";	monthNames[3]="April";	monthNames[4]="May";	monthNames[5]="June";	monthNames[6]="July";	monthNames[7]="August";	monthNames[8]="September";	monthNames[9]="October";	monthNames[10]="November";	monthNames[11]="December";			var now = new Date();	var century;		if(now.getYear()>=0 && now.getYear()<=100) {		if (now.getYear()>="98") {			century="19";		}		else {			century="20";		}				document.writeln(dayNames[now.getDay()] + ", " + monthNames[now.getMonth()] + " " + now.getDate() + ", " + century + now.getYear());	}	else {		// if the year isn't working right, write the lastmodified property		if(document.lastModified) {			document.writeln(document.lastModified);		}	}}function selectDefault() {	eventsActive=true;	if(selectedButton!="") {		norm(selectedButton)		if(selectedParent!="") {			norm(selectedParent)						if(selectedChildNum>0) {				if (document.images) {					var btnImage = new Image()				  btnImage.src = navbarImagePath + selectedParent + "L" + selectedChildNum + "." + extension									// swap in the loaded line graphic					document.images[(selectedParent + "L")].src=btnImage.src				}								}		}	}}function reselectDefault() {	if (eventsActive) {		resizeFix();		selectDefault();	}}function makeArray(rCount) {	this.length=rCount;	for(var i=1; i<=rCount; i++)		this[i]=0			return this}function addToButtonArray(rimgName) {	buttonCount++	buttonNames[buttonCount]=rimgName}function normalButtonImage(rimgName, rPath) {	var btnImage = new Image()	if (selectedButton!=rimgName && selectedParent!=rimgName)	   btnImage.src = rPath + rimgName + "N." + extension	else	   btnImage.src = rPath + rimgName + "S." + extension			return btnImage}function rolloverButtonImage(rimgName, rPath) {	//determine if we have varying rollover images	if(rolloverButtonImage.arguments.length>2) {		var iImageNum = rolloverButtonImage.arguments[2]		var bVaryingRollover=true	}	else		var bVaryingRollover=false		var btnImage = new Image()	if(!bVaryingRollover)		btnImage.src = rPath + rimgName + "R." + extension	else		btnImage.src = rPath + rimgName + "R" + iImageNum + "." + extension		return btnImage}function multirollo(rbtnNameA, rbtnNameB) {  if (document.images && eventsActive) {  	// Determine if we have optional rollover image numbers		// This is needed to support varying rollover popup graphics for a given button			if(multirollo.arguments.length>2) {	 	  var bVaryingRollover = true	  	var iImageNumA = multirollo.arguments[2]	  	var iImageNumB = multirollo.arguments[3]	  }		else	  	var bVaryingRollover = false		   	  /* Norm the last rolled over button(s) to be safe*/		if (lastRollo!="" && lastRollo!=rbtnNameA && lastRollo!=rbtnNameB) {			norm(lastRollo)		}		if (lastRollo2!="" && lastRollo2!=rbtnNameA && lastRollo2!=rbtnNameB) {			norm(lastRollo2)		}		if(selectedButton!=rbtnNameA) {							if(bVaryingRollover) {				document[rbtnNameA].src =eval(rbtnNameA + "R" + iImageNumA +".src")				document[rbtnNameB].src =eval(rbtnNameB + "R" + iImageNumB +".src")			}	   	else {		   	document[rbtnNameA].src =eval(rbtnNameA + "R.src")	  	 	document[rbtnNameB].src =eval(rbtnNameB + "R.src")			}				lastRollo=rbtnNameA			lastRollo2=rbtnNameB		}	}}function multinorm(rbtnNameA, rbtnNameB) {  if (document.images) {  	document[rbtnNameA].src =eval(rbtnNameA + "N.src")		document[rbtnNameB].src =eval(rbtnNameB + "N.src")		lastRollo=""		lastRollo2=""  }}function norm(rbtnName) {  if (document.images) {		document[rbtnName].src =eval(rbtnName + "N.src")		lastRollo=""	}}function rollo(rbtnName) {  if (document.images && eventsActive) {		//previously we normed all other buttons for mac bug fix.. now norm only the last rolled over			if (lastRollo!="" && lastRollo!=rbtnName) {				norm(lastRollo)			}			if (lastRollo2!="" && lastRollo2!=rbtnName) {				norm(lastRollo2)			}				if(selectedButton!=rbtnName) {			if(rollo.arguments.length>1) {  	  	var iImageNum = rollo.arguments[1]	 			document[rbtnName].src =eval(rbtnName + "R" + iImageNum + ".src")			}			else				document[rbtnName].src =eval(rbtnName + "R.src")						lastRollo=rbtnName		}	}}function resizeFix() {    if (saveInnerWidth < window.innerWidth ||         saveInnerWidth > window.innerWidth ||         saveInnerHeight > window.innerHeight ||         saveInnerHeight < window.innerHeight )  {      window.history.go(0);    }}// -->